Patient data is an asset and a liability—here’s how to avoid costly missteps

Cure: Eileen Anderson, director of the Inamori International Center for Ethics and Excellence and the Inamori Professor in Ethics, discussed how when you’re forming a new biotech or life sciences company, it's important to become good stewards of the patient data you collect. "As you begin, make the focus your patient, not the dataset. Be transparent and explain how the data will be used and why you’re collecting it," Eileen Anderson said.
